VU54 AVD is a 2004 Lexus SC430 in Silver with a 4,293c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 85%.
Across all 2004 Lexus SC430 models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.3% with a typical mileage of 63,512 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Lexus SC430 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 1,270 recorded failures. If you're considering buying VU54 AVD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Lexus SC430 typ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 22 years old, this Lexus SC430 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
